The Birth of an American Dream: Ralph Lauren’s Journey
Ralph Lauren, originally named Ralph Lifshitz, was born in the Bronx, New York City, in 1939. His journey from a working-class background to becoming one of the most influential figures in the fashion industry is nothing short of inspiring. Lauren started his career selling ties out of the back of a car before founding his eponymous brand in 1967. The launch of the iconic Polo shirt in 1972 marked a turning point, transforming the brand into a symbol of American style and luxury.
The Polo shirt, with its signature embroidered polo player logo, quickly became a staple in wardrobes across the country and beyond. It represented a blend of athleticism, casual chic, and an aspirational lifestyle that resonated deeply with the American public. This shirt wasn’t just a piece of clothing; it was a statement of class and taste.
American Heritage Meets Global Influence
Over the decades, Ralph Lauren has expanded its portfolio to include a wide range of products, from ready-to-wear collections to home decor, all infused with the brand’s distinctive American aesthetic. The company has successfully tapped into the nostalgia and romance of the American past, from the preppy Ivy League look to the rugged cowboy style, creating a brand identity that is both timeless and aspirational.
But Ralph Lauren isn’t just about celebrating the past; it’s also about embracing the future. The brand has continued to innovate and evolve, staying relevant in a rapidly changing fashion landscape. By collaborating with contemporary designers and leveraging digital platforms, Ralph Lauren has managed to maintain its position as a leader in luxury fashion while appealing to new generations of consumers.
